From patchwork Wed Jun 20 15:56:54 2012 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Bharat Bhushan X-Patchwork-Id: 166113 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by ozlabs.org (Postfix) with ESMTP id 786F8B6FD4 for ; Thu, 21 Jun 2012 01:52:00 +1000 (EST)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1756894Ab2FTPv7 (ORCPT ); Wed, 20 Jun 2012 11:51:59 -0400 Received: from ch1ehsobe004.messaging.microsoft.com ([216.32.181.184]:18358 "EHLO ch1outboundpool.messaging.microsoft.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1756874Ab2FTPv6 (ORCPT ); Wed, 20 Jun 2012 11:51:58 -0400 Received: from mail5-ch1-R.bigfish.com (10.43.68.249) by CH1EHSOBE017.bigfish.com (10.43.70.67) with Microsoft SMTP Server id 14.1.225.23; Wed, 20 Jun 2012 15:50:34 +0000 Received: from mail5-ch1 (localhost [127.0.0.1]) by mail5-ch1-R.bigfish.com (Postfix) with ESMTP id CDB21140306; Wed, 20 Jun 2012 15:50:33 +0000 (UTC) X-Forefront-Antispam-Report: CIP:70.37.183.190; KIP:(null); UIP:(null); IPV:NLI; H:mail.freescale.net; RD:none; EFVD:NLI X-SpamScore: 18 X-BigFish: VS18(z35f3wzzz1202h1082kzz8275bhz2dh2a8h668h839hd24he5bhf0ah) Received: from mail5-ch1 (localhost.localdomain [127.0.0.1]) by mail5-ch1 (MessageSwitch) id 1340207432127732_17393; Wed, 20 Jun 2012 15:50:32 +0000 (UTC) Received: from CH1EHSMHS002.bigfish.com (snatpool1.int.messaging.microsoft.com [10.43.68.246]) by mail5-ch1.bigfish.com (Postfix) with ESMTP id 1D157120225; Wed, 20 Jun 2012 15:50:32 +0000 (UTC) Received: from mail.freescale.net (70.37.183.190) by CH1EHSMHS002.bigfish.com (10.43.70.2) with Microsoft SMTP Server (TLS) id 14.1.225.23; Wed, 20 Jun 2012 15:50:31 +0000 Received: from az84smr01.freescale.net (10.64.34.197) by 039-SN1MMR1-002.039d.mgd.msft.net (10.84.1.15) with Microsoft SMTP Server (TLS) id 14.2.298.5; Wed, 20 Jun 2012 10:51:54 -0500 Received: from freescale.com ([10.232.15.72]) by az84smr01.freescale.net (8.14.3/8.14.0) with SMTP id q5KFpoAZ015094; Wed, 20 Jun 2012 08:51:51 -0700 Received: by freescale.com (sSMTP sendmail emulation); Wed, 20 Jun 2012 21:27:17 +0530 From: Bharat Bhushan To: , , CC: Bharat Bhushan Subject: [PATCH 2/2] booke: Added crit/mc exception handler for e500v2 Date: Wed, 20 Jun 2012 21:26:54 +0530 Message-ID: <1340207814-9093-2-git-send-email-bharat.bhushan@freescale.com> X-Mailer: git-send-email 1.7.0.4 In-Reply-To: <1340207814-9093-1-git-send-email-bharat.bhushan@freescale.com> References: <1340207814-9093-1-git-send-email-bharat.bhushan@freescale.com> MIME-Version: 1.0 X-OriginatorOrg: freescale.com Sender: kvm-ppc-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: kvm-ppc@vger.kernel.org Watchdog is taken at critical exception level. So this patch is tested with host watchdog exception happening when guest is running. Signed-off-by: Bharat Bhushan --- arch/powerpc/kvm/booke_interrupts.S | 55 +++++++++++++++++------------------ 1 files changed, 27 insertions(+), 28 deletions(-) diff --git a/arch/powerpc/kvm/booke_interrupts.S b/arch/powerpc/kvm/booke_interrupts.S index 8feec2f..09456c4 100644 --- a/arch/powerpc/kvm/booke_interrupts.S +++ b/arch/powerpc/kvm/booke_interrupts.S @@ -53,16 +53,21 @@ (1<